Main duties of the job

The successful candidate will deliver a full range of general practice nursing services, including the management of long-term conditions such as asthma & COPD. You will also be involved in childhood and adult immunisations, cervical screening, wound care and health promotion supporting patients to make positive lifestyle changes.

You will be expected to prove holistic care, maintain accurate clinical records in line with standards set by the Nursing and Midwifery Council and contribute to the ongoing development of clinical services within the practice. The role also involves participating in clinical governance and leading infection control standards, supporting colleagues, and engaging in continuous professional development.

Major Duties and Responsibilities

NB It is recognised that additional training will be required for some of the tasks listed. Applicants to the post are not expected to be proficient in all tasks listed.

  • Assist in and perform routine tasks related to patient care as directed by senior nursing staff and GPs
  • Cervical Cytology
  • Wound care / ulcer care
  • Removal of Sutures
  • Urinalysis
  • ECGs
  • Asthma & COPD management
  • Venipuncture
  • Hypertension Management
  • Ear syringing
  • Routine immunisations/Childhood immunisations
  • Chaperoning and assisting patients where appropriate who are being examined by another clinician
  • Assisting GPs with minor surgery and coil fittings
  • Requesting pathology tests, for example urine culture, swabs
  • Following agreed clinical protocols with referral to senior nurse or GPs as appropriate
  • Infection control
